Animal Cell Technology course 2014 – 4th edition
September 28 – October 2, 2014, Llafranc, Spain
Coordinators: Francesc Gòdia (UAB, Spain) and Paula Alves (IBET, Portugal) After the interest received by the 1st, 2nd and 3rd edition and the excellent feed-back from the attendants, the 4th edition of the ACT course will be organised by the ESACT (European Society of Animal Cell Technology) in Llafranc, Costa Brava/Spain, from 28th September to 2nd October 2014. ESACT is presenting this activity as one more contribution to the community involved in the use of animal cells in Biotechnology and Biomedicine. The Course is planned in an intensive four-day schedule with a number of participants limited to 30 in order to facilitate the interaction among them and with the lecturers. Lecturers will stay for most of the Course duration. The Course comprises lectures covering the main topics of Animal Cell Technology:- Cell line development
- Cellular mechanisms
- Post-translational modifications
- Bioreactor design
- Downstream processing
- Genomics and proteomics
- Bioreactor scale-up and scale-down. Single use bioreactors
- Process Analytical Technology
- Economical aspects of ACT bioprocesses
- Integrated bioprocess for protein production
- Integrated bioprocess for stem cells
